Developments in Design Law: coming to Dublin soon
The Association of Patent and Trade Mark Attorneys (APTMA) in Ireland, whose eye-catching logo appears on the right, together with the Irish group of the AIPPI, are holding a seminar, "Developments in Design Law", on recent developments in design law.

David Stone (Simmons & Simmons partner, author of European Union Design Law: A Practitioners’ Guide and chair of the MARQUES Designs Team) will discuss recent developments in EU Design law. The seminar will also include a special focus on the recent Karen Millen decision of the Court of Justice of the European Union (Case C-345/13, noted on Class 46 here).
If you'd like to attend -- and all are welcome -- the event takes place on 21 October 2014 and the venue is Chartered Accountants House, Pearse St, Dublin 2, Ireland. Be there for a 6 pm start.
